fifty-six million, nine hundred ninety-three thousand, eight hundred eighty-three
Currency $56993883 in american english: fifty-six million, nine hundred ninety-three thousand, eight hundred eighty-three US Dollars.
In Price: 56993883.00
55993883 | 57993883